How Long Do Reusable Glass Containers Typically Last?

Reusable glass containers typically last for several years, thanks to their material durability. With proper care, they often have a storage lifespan of 5 to 10 years or more. You should avoid sudden temperature changes and use gentle cleaning methods to prevent cracks or chips. When maintained well, your glass containers will serve you reliably, making them a sustainable and long-lasting storage solution for your kitchen needs.

Can Silicone Lids Create an Airtight Seal?

Yes, silicone lids can create an airtight seal, but it depends on their design and quality. Silicone’s durability allows it to flex and conform tightly over containers, enhancing airtight performance. However, not all silicone lids are equal—some may lose their seal over time or with frequent use. For the best results, choose high-quality, flexible silicone lids designed specifically for airtight storage, and you’ll keep your food fresher longer.

What Are the Best Cleaning Practices for These Materials?

You should clean glass, stainless steel, and silicone storage containers regularly to maintain their durability and guarantee they’re hygienic. Use warm, soapy water and a soft sponge or brush for daily cleaning. For tougher stains or odors, consider vinegar or baking soda solutions. Avoid abrasive scrubbers that can scratch surfaces. Regular cleaning frequency depends on use, but aim to wash them after each use to keep your containers in top condition.
